Role Models (2008)

[Movie 172 / Day 189]


Danny and Wheeler are two friends and colleagues who manage to get themselves sentenced to 150 hours of community service, which takes the form of mentoring a couple of kids. Although they only do it to escape a prison sentence, they end up becoming better people, naturally.

Paul Rudd is a brilliant comedic actor, as is Seann William Scott (although they both seem to play more or less the same character in every film they're in); together they're pretty funny.

Far better than I was expecting.

Zack & Miri Make a Porno (2008)

[Movie 130 / Day 114]


I'm a big Kevin Smith fan. I love Seth Rogen. So I thought I would be in for a treat watching the Rogen in Smith's latest offering. Handily I was right, Z&M is an excellent comedy full of the best Kevin Smith traditions.

Elizabeth Banks is hot, Seth Rogen is a complete dude, Kevin Smith's dialogue is as sharp as ever - it all adds up to good times.

Props to Justin Long for a gloriously OTT portrayal of a gay porn star.

Spider-Man 2 (2004)

[Movie 123 / Day 103]


One of those rare beasts, a sequel that's actually better than the original. It's more of the same, but with the backstory covered in the first film, the second concentrates on developing the characters and their relationships more whilst serving up some excellent action sequences.

I guess Kirsten Dunst was a big enough name to veto the thin/wet dress in this one though.

Spider-Man (2002)

[Movie 121 / Day 103]


Nerdy boy gets bitten by a genetically modified spider and somehow gains superpowers.

It's OK, but a bit long. The best thing about it is J.K. Simmons portrayal of Daily Bugle editor JJ Jameson. He's absolutely brilliant. The second best thing is Kirsten Dunst in a thin dress in the rain. Actually, that might be the wrong way round.

The 40 Year Old Virgin (2005)

[Movie 50 / Day 31]


I'm not a big fan of Steve Carell. I didn't find him particularly funny in Anchorman, not even the infamous "I love lamp" scene.

I don't find this movie massively funny. It has few true laugh moments. Yet, for some reason, I really like it. I think it helps that I really like both Paul Rudd (massively under-rated IMO) and Seth Rogen.

Simple plot. 40 year old bloke is a virgin. His friends try and help him lose his virginity. He falls in love with a girl. Loses virginity.

No amazing plot, or clever twists, no massive laughs, and yet it's enjoyable. I especially love the singalong finish.
